BBC launches Jainism website

Submitted 24th December 2003

Link: www.bbc.co.uk/religion/religions/jainism

BBC Religion and Ethics launched the Jainism website on 7th December 2003 which communicates the philosophy and culture of Jain Religion. The launch of the BBCI Jainism website is a pioneering development in communicating the essence of Jain culture. The newly launched website will allow people worldwide to appreciate and understand the Jain values of ahimsa, aparigraha and annekant as a highly relevant and essential part of modern living. Oshwal Academy, Mombasa, Kenya

Submitted 21st October 2003

Link: http://www.oshwal-academy.com

Oshwal Academy was founded in 1968 as Oshwal Secondary School. The Academy is owned and managed by Oshwal Education and Relief Board.

Fats used in Colgate Palmolive Products

Submitted 1st October 2003

From: “Colgate-Palmolive Consumer Affairs”

Dear Ms Shah

Thank you for contacting us with your question. We appreciate the opportunity to provide information regarding animal fats used in Colgate-Palmolive products sold in the United States.

All of Colgate-Palmolive Company’s soaps contain tallow. The tallowates used in these soaps are obtained only from beef tallow. In addition, the glycerin in these soaps is certified as pork free.
